Albert #2 Posted November 3, 2005 I assume you mean Marble Craze? It should work fine on your heavy sixer, although since it works fine on your other system it's tough to say what exactly the problem might be. I have seen compatibility problems with individual carts (not just Marble Craze) and oddball 2600 systems, but they are pretty rare. Sometimes it's a bad power supply causing the problems. Other times it's a flakey system. And sometimes it's a bad cart. D.Yancey #3 Posted November 4, 2005 Try another cart in Big Sexy to make sure it is working properly. If yes, then try Marble Craze again and try to move it around in the slot a little while you turn the system slowly off and on a few times too see what response you get. I've seen Activision carts that have to be pampered like this quite often. Good luck! Quote Share this post Link to post Share on other sites
